Technical details Ethereal

DATA & DIMENSIONS

Yard no.384
TypePerformance Ketch - The world's first hybrid superyacht
Naval architectRon Holland Design
Exterior designPieter Beeldsnijder Design / Ron Holland Design
Interior architectPieter Beeldsnijder Design
Length overall58m / 190ft
Year of Delivery2009
Story Ethereal

Classic lines, pioneering technologies. Every new project presents its own challenges but the creation of Ethereal called for an unprecedented level of technological innovation and expertise, even by the standards of Royal Huisman. 

It all started when owners Bill and Shannon Joy travelled to Holland to meet the team at Royal Huisman. They were inspired by the beautiful 43m Ron Holland and Pieter Beeldsnijder designed ketch Juliet, built by Royal Huisman, that they had often sailed aboard and which they loved. The Joys dreamed of building a yacht with similarly graceful lines and sailing performance, while using the latest technology and best operational practices to minimize its environmental impact.

Working together, as they had on Juliet, master architects Ron Holland and Pieter Beeldsnijder gave Ethereal her beautiful lines and her clean styling that blends new and traditional elements. They also gave her outstanding performance and quality accommodation for 10-12 guests and 10 crew.

A three-day design charrette was convened at Royal Huisman where the yard engineers teamed up with an international group of experts, academics and suppliers, evaluating all ship’s systems and thinking outside the box to identify innovative ways to reduce Ethereal’s environmental impact and increase her energy efficiency. Thus began a restless search for new, lower impact solutions to traditional problems, a focused search that continued throughout and defined the spirit of the Ethereal project.

The result is a magnificent 58m / 190ft classic ketch that uses only a fraction of the energy of comparable yachts. The world's first hybrid superyacht. Her elegant lines — a well proportioned superstructure, fine bow, low freeboard, beautiful sail plan and sleek stern — complement her pioneering systems. Ethereal’s design and many innovations set a high standard for the large sailing yachts to be built in the years to come.
